00:44 (21:44)Putin's Mongolian Gambit

Russian headlines focus on Putin's official visit to Mongolia (TASS, Gazeta.ru, NTV.ru), which is significant as Mongolia is an International Criminal Court member state. This visit raises questions about Putin's international standing and potential legal implications (The Moscow Times). Concurrently, there's coverage of the US confiscating Venezuelan President Maduro's plane (Interfax.ru, Izvestia, RT). Military operations are also reported, with claims of Russian advances near Pokrovsk causing concern in Ukraine (Komsomolskaya Pravda, Lenta.ru). Additionally, economic news includes a significant drop in the Moscow Exchange Index (Kommersant).

20:23 (17:23)Deadly Russian Strike on Poltava Military Institute

Russian headlines focus heavily on a major missile strike by Russian forces on a military communications institute in Poltava, Ukraine. Multiple sources (Meduza, The Moscow Times, RIA Novosti, TASS) report high casualties, with over 50 dead and more than 200 injured. The strike reportedly hit both the military facility and a nearby hospital. In domestic news, several outlets (Interfax.ru, Kommersant, Rossiyskaya Gazeta) report the arrest of General Mumindjanov, deputy commander of the Leningrad Military District, on corruption charges. Putin's visit to Mongolia is also mentioned (NTV.ru), with the EU expressing regret over Mongolia's refusal to arrest Putin (RT).

21:44 (18:44)Zelensky Claims Hold on Kursk Territories

The Russian headlines report on President Zelensky's statement about Ukrainian plans to hold territories in Kursk Oblast (Gazeta.ru, Lenta.ru, Meduza). Several sources (Interfax.ru, Kommersant, Rossiyskaya Gazeta, TASS) cover the arrest of General Mumindjanov, deputy commander of the Leningrad Military District, on corruption charges. The Moscow Times reports on a Russian strike killing dozens in a Ukrainian city, hitting a military education facility and a nearby hospital. Komsomolskaya Pravda discusses a strategic error by Ukrainian military leadership, suggesting Ukrainian forces have been led into a "cauldron" near Pokrovsk.
